Main information about car part NPS 120022410
Producer NPS
Number 120022410
Description Clutch Pressure Plate
Analogue of NPS 120022410
NPS NPS H210A33 H210A33 Clutch Pressure Plate
The other parts with the same number "120022410"
AUTOMEGA 120022410 Cable, manual transmission
LUK 120 0224 10 Clutch Pressure Plate